|
68.99 23-QT PC
This pressure cooker is 23 Quarts, I fit ten in there - It takes ten minutes to heat up, another twenty minutes or so to reach pressure, another 90 mins to sterilize, another thirty minutes to decompress -
repeat x 7
And thats ten a piece.

None, I can do 30 Jars in seven hours, without missing a beat.
Thats with it on the burner the whole time.. I put two inches of water in there to be safe, by the time its done, its like it never lost a drop, though I still use two inches to be safe, in case I doze off or something.
I actually just bought a AA 941 on amazon, than a few hours later I canceled because I thought to myself, the hell do I need a new one for
( yeah Its nice that the 941 does 19 Quart Jars at once ) but for 400$ I dont need that function, not at this time in my hobby. I say in a few months I will though.
